PTdoughnut had a good suggestion on looking on the forums but I don't agree with him saying you wont need it. Think about it like Anti-lock brakes. You don't need them till you need them. The damper is a safety device and you wont even know if it works if it is installed but if its not there then you will see if you need one. The only problem with that is you may need a new bike if you realize you should have had one. You need to decide if it is worth the cost vs risk which is a decision we all make. I would recommend if you can afford one, either from the dealer or after market, then get one if not then be careful while learning your new bike, ride safe and post lots of pics and videos.

Just FYI I do not have a steering damper on the NINJA or my SV but I do have one on my Ducati because it lifts the wheel under acceleration and even a small bump in the road will cause the front tire to lift if you are on the throttle so there are many chances for the front to get wobbly.
